Super Bowl XLVI Pre-Game Events & Activities, Part 2: 10 Days to Kickoff

Yes, it’s true. Super Bowl XLVI is just 10 days away! After all the hubbub, pre-game events officially begin tomorrow, Friday, January 27th. Last week, we took a look at the Super Bowl Village and The Huddle. Today, we’ll discuss the NFL Experience at the Convention Center.

The NFL Experience is a pro football interactive theme park produced by the National Football League. The NFL Experience offers fans the opportunity to be a football star.

Taking place in the 500,000 square-foot space of the Indiana Convention Center, activities at the NFL Experience include:

  • Participatory games
  • Displays
  • Entertainment attractions
  • Kids’ football clinics
  • Free autograph sessions
  • The largest football memorabilia show ever

Getting There

As we mentioned in our post about Super Bowl event parking, parking downtown could be problematic. Probably the best alternative is Park and Ride. For $2.00 a person, you can reserve a parking spot at one of three locations and ride a convenient shuttle right to all the downtown activities.
